Shares of Transition Metals Corp. (CVE:XTM – Get Free Report) were up 42.9% during mid-day trading on Thursday . The stock traded as high as C$0.05 and last traded at C$0.05. Approximately 212,433 shares traded hands during trading, an increase of 158% from the average daily volume of 82,286 shares. The stock had previously closed at C$0.04.
Transition Metals Price Performance
The firm has a market cap of C$3.58 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of -2.73 and a beta of 1.73. The stock has a 50-day moving average price of C$0.04 and a 200 day moving average price of C$0.06.
Transition Metals Company Profile
Transition Metals Corp. engages in the acquisition and exploration of mineral properties in Canada and the United States. It explores for gold, silver, copper, nickel, platinum group metal, and palladium. The company engages in various projects, that includes the Thunder Bay, Pike Warden, Saskatchewan, Abitibi gold, Sudbury Area, and other projects.
